Benzonatate Capsule is indicated for the symptomatic relief of cough.
Adults and Children over 10 years of age: Usual dose is one 100 mg or 200 mg capsule three times a day as needed for cough. If necessary to control cough, up to 600 mg daily in three divided doses may be given.
Hypersensitivity to benzonatate or related compounds.
Benzonatate, a non-narcotic oral antitussive agent, is 2, 5, 8, 11, 14, 17, 20, 23, 26-nonaoxaoctacosan-28-yl p-(butylamino) benzoate; with a molecular weight of 603.7.

Each Benzonatate Capsules USP contains: Benzonatate, USP 100 mg or 200 mg.
Benzonatate Capsules USP also contain: D&C Yellow 10, gelatin, glycerin, methylparaben, propylparaben and titanium dioxide.
Benzonatate Capsule acts peripherally by anesthetizing the stretch receptors located in the respiratory passages, lungs, and pleura by dampening their activity and thereby reducing the cough reflex at its source. It begins to act within 15 to 20 minutes and its effect lasts for 3 to 8 hours. Benzonatate Capsule has no inhibitory effect on the respiratory center in recommended dosage.
